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Berwick-upon-Tweed to Riding Mill start from as little as £23.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Berwick-upon-Tweed to Riding Mill start from £22.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Berwick-upon-Tweed to Riding Mill are available for £26.70 one way

Facilities and Amenities at Berwick-upon-Tweed Station

Berwick-upon-Tweed Station boasts a variety of facilities to make your travel experience smooth and comfortable. The ticket office is open from 7 AM to 4 PM on weekdays, with slightly adjusted hours on weekends. There are ticket machines available for those who prefer to purchase or collect tickets electronically. Don’t worry about accessibility, as the station is equipped with step-free access throughout, making it friendly for all passengers.

Facilities also include amenities such as waiting rooms, heated for the cooler months, and accessible-height seating available on the platforms. If nature calls, rest assured that toilets, including accessible toilets and baby-changing facilities, are stationed in the Main Entrance Hall and on both platforms.

Transport Links from Berwick-upon-Tweed Station

This station is well-connected to local transport options. You can find rail replacement coaches departing from the front of the station. For a quick taxi ride, consider contacting A1 Cabs, Fifes, or Berwick taxis, which usually do not require advance booking unless you’re travelling early morning or late at night. Bus information to plan your onward adventures is handy and even available in a printable format.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

The station is equipped with basic yet vital facilities. Ticket purchasing is streamlined thanks to the presence of ticket machines that allow you to collect your tickets with ease. Unfortunately, there is no staffed ticket office or accessible ticket machines, but an induction loop is available. CCTV ensures safety around the station.

Regarding accessibility, Riding Mill falls under Category B, which indicates partial step-free access. There is a level access to the Carlisle platform, while reaching the Newcastle platform involves either a footbridge or a 700-meter partially unlit road. Boarding ramps are available and assistance can be arranged via the Passenger Assist program.

Onward Travel Options

For those looking to journey beyond the station, there are several travel links available. Rail replacement services can be found on St. James Terrace, conveniently situated by the Wellington Pub. Pull up your phone and check out the cab options if taxis are your preferred mode. In terms of public transport, there’s a nearby bus stop served by Busline, and for enquiries, you can reach them at 0871 200 2233.
